Output e602416759e129669f75e7c5fe20d6ee448cecdd0ae07a175b91d502302b836e:2

value
3085096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47d9dbf998911667a2947a5459c7032609313ca9 OP_EQUALVERIFY OP_CHECKSIG
address
17YuxkNzbAn6Mck9VBcpn3n87y2xA1qLnA
transaction
e602416759e129669f75e7c5fe20d6ee448cecdd0ae07a175b91d502302b836e
confirmations
391247
spent
true